    In this paper, the authors prove that a certain conjecture of Margulis for cocompact lattices and a fixed positive integer \(s\) is equivalent to Lehmer's conjecture about Mahler measure for integer polynomials with exactly \(s\) roots outside the unit circle. So far none is proved even for \(s=1\), which corresponds to the conjecture that the set of Salem numbers is bounded away from 1. The authors also discuss some other algebraic conjectures which would imply Lehmer's conjecture in full or in some special cases.
